Monthly can be good enough.
2013 Honda Fit, EPA combined rating 29 mpg.
In three months it's gone 6674.6 miles at 43.4 mpg.
That cost $548 in gas, saving $271.63 against the EPA rating.
With a monthly payment of $286, hypermiling has saved me nearly one payment in three.

Compared to what I would have spent on gas if I'd done those miles in the Albatross at 18 mpg, saving gas in the Honda has offset all but $85 in payments. If I compare it to the Albatross' 15 mpg EPA rating, my savings put me $178.11 ahead of my payments- all in three months.
